About This Tool

Img to Icon converts a source image into a ready-to-use favicon and app icon pack directly in your browser. Upload a PNG, JPG, WebP, or SVG file, then tune how the image fits into square icon sizes.

You can choose fit, crop, or stretch mode, use a transparent background or solid color, adjust padding, round the icon corners, preview common favicon and app icon sizes, and export everything without uploading the source image.

Favicon and app icon exports

The generated pack includes favicon.ico, favicon PNG sizes, Apple touch icon, Android Chrome icons, PWA icon files, site.webmanifest, and an HTML snippet for adding the icons to a website.

Frequently Asked Questions

Are images uploaded?

No. Img to Icon uses browser image decoding and canvas rendering, so images stay on your device during normal website use.

Can I create favicon.ico?

Yes. The tool creates favicon.ico with 16px, 32px, and 48px PNG entries for modern browsers.

Which image formats are supported?

The tool accepts common browser-readable image formats including PNG, JPG, JPEG, WebP, and SVG.

What is included in the icon pack?

The ZIP includes favicon.ico, PNG favicon sizes, Apple touch icon, Android Chrome icons, site.webmanifest, and an HTML snippet.

Can I make PWA icons?

Yes. The ZIP includes 192px and 512px PWA icon files and a site.webmanifest that can be used by installable web apps.

Can the icon use a transparent background?

Yes. You can keep transparency when the source supports it, or choose a solid background color for consistent website and app icons.
